Output 676065c794c43f16f090e2bc37e65f3b7bc06a3816ad2295de9ff391bf1bcece:4

value
27180669
script pubkey
OP_HASH160 OP_PUSHBYTES_20 99db9a887f95641c441eb84b97ff80b6c6d78af8 OP_EQUAL
address
MMvgh7Gyd1MeJ61T24YLCriUWnKfgBndA1
transaction
676065c794c43f16f090e2bc37e65f3b7bc06a3816ad2295de9ff391bf1bcece
spent
true